The Fair is in town! The Aberfeldy Highland Show is an annual event that attracts thousands of folk from far afield. The show is spread over two days with plenty of good honest country activities and fun!

For example, comparing the ‘length and girth of your Leek with other people, Cow, Pig and Sheep Fancying, also, Dancing like a whirling dervish under the influence of ‘healthy’ amounts of fine beer and whiskey (commonly known as a Ceildih).

There is ‘Throwing the Wellie Boot’, Tea and Cake tents. A Tug-O-War, Tractor and agricultural show…………..amongst other things!!

Here at SPLASH we take our responsibility for you, the client very seriously. We are constantly training and updating our procedures to stay ahead of the game.

Full Credit and sincere thanks must be given to Ocean Medical Training. Operated by Rod Cain an ex- Paratrooper with years of experience of real life trauma in a military and civilian capacity. He is a member of The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h and a HSE & Maritime and Coastguard Agency Approved First Aid Instructor, (amongst other things!)

Rod took a number of our Trip Leaders through a comprehensive 12 hr. course in Advanced First Aid Procedure, covering every injury and ailment that we are likely to encounter during the course of our work, plus some real-time scenarios with a few surprises thrown in to keep us on our toes!

What it boils down to is that ‘Prevention is always better than Cure’, but if it comes to the crunch (no pun intended!) we want to know that you are in the best, safe and qualified hands of any team operating in the field.
